Not known Details About what is md5 technology
Not known Details About what is md5 technology
Blog Article
On thirty December 2008, a group of researchers introduced at the 25th Chaos Conversation Congress how they had used MD5 collisions to produce an intermediate certificate authority certificate that gave the impression to be genuine when checked by its MD5 hash.[24] The scientists used a PS3 cluster for the EPFL in Lausanne, Switzerland[38] to change a standard SSL certificate issued by RapidSSL into a Functioning CA certificate for that issuer, which could then be applied to develop other certificates that would seem to become legit and issued by RapidSSL. Verisign, the issuers of RapidSSL certificates, stated they stopped issuing new certificates employing MD5 as their checksum algorithm for RapidSSL once the vulnerability was declared.
Now, let's go forward to implementing MD5 in code. Be aware that for functional uses, it is usually recommended to make use of stronger hashing algorithms like SHA-256 rather than MD5.
Compromised aspects integrated usernames, e-mail and IP addresses and passwords stored as both salted MD5 or bcrypt hashes.
Specified such occurrences, cybercriminals could presumably swap a real file using a malicious file that generates a similar hash. To battle this risk, newer variations on the algorithm happen to be developed, namely SHA-2 and SHA-three, and are advisable for safer practices.
It had been released in the general public area a 12 months later. Just a yr later on a “pseudo-collision” in the MD5 compression perform was identified. The timeline of MD5 uncovered (and exploited) vulnerabilities is as follows:
Picture you've got just penned the most beautiful letter to the Close friend abroad, but you desire to ensure it won't get tampered with in the course of its journey. You decide to seal the envelope, but as an alternative to using just any outdated sticker, you utilize a singular, uncopyable seal.
Greatly Supported: MD5 supports broad programming libraries, techniques, and resources due to its historic prominence and simplicity. It's got contributed to its common use in legacy programs and systems.
This one of a kind hash value is intended to become practically unattainable to reverse engineer, which makes it a good Device for verifying knowledge integrity for the duration of conversation and storage.
Regardless of the regarded stability vulnerabilities and issues, MD5 is still employed nowadays Regardless that more secure solutions now exist. Stability challenges with MD5
Even though MD5 was as soon as a commonly adopted cryptographic hash function, many critical negatives have been recognized eventually, leading to its decrease in use for stability-associated apps. They involve:
The MD5 hash purpose’s safety is considered to be seriously compromised. Collisions can be found within just seconds, and they can be useful for malicious applications. The truth is, in 2012, the Flame spyware that infiltrated 1000s of computers and products in Iran was regarded as on the list of most troublesome safety problems with the calendar year.
When computers had been a lot less complicated, MD5’s cryptographic signatures have been productive at protecting information despatched around the web towards hackers. That’s website not the situation any more.
Hash algorithms ongoing to progress in the ensuing many years, but the very first murmurs of cryptographic hash features didn’t look until eventually the nineteen seventies.
Among the key weaknesses of MD5 is its vulnerability to collision attacks. In uncomplicated terms, a collision takes place when two distinct inputs deliver the identical hash output. Which is like two distinct people today possessing a similar fingerprint—shouldn't transpire, suitable?